I may well have the worlds least reliable Volvo. I have an 05 V50, earlier this year the clutch went, resulting in a four figure bill. A few weeks later the little end went (not that I know what this is) and I had to buy a whole new engine, thus another substantial four figure bill. Now just a couple of months later, I get in the car after work and there is an odd whining noise. Then the 'Power System Service Urgent' message appeared. A quick look on-line suggests that this would be the alternator.
Has anyone had this alternator issue? If so how much did it cost to fix? Do you have the part number?

Volvo had a reputation for reliability, but as far as I am concerned this is the least reliable car that I have ever owned.
